Hey — quick handover on the Spindrift metrics sidecar before I'm out. It scrapes app pods every 15s and batches to the Coalpit aggregator. Known quirk: it leaks memory under high-cardinality labels, so we restart it weekly via cron. Don't touch the flush interval without checking with Priya first. Config, dashboards, and the restart procedure are all documented here.

operations page: https://harbor.zarqeldata.local/deploy/ticket/board/dash/board/display/dash/58c2ec1e4245aecb18b1fc8f

Runbook 9-B: Test Device Case. Heads up, records folks — the locked Pelham-style case holding the Wrenlock prototype handsets moves between the Copperfield lab and the Danegate test site every other Friday. Count the devices against the sheet before the lid closes, and note the padlock seal number in the log. The case never leaves the courier's sight, and nobody at either end opens it without both sign-offs. When the courier reaches Danegate reception, the hand-over works like this.

handover note for yagef-bagep: the drudor pelius courier leaves the kasdor zorvan norir ledger at gate 8016 under passcode 755406

Runbook fragment — Flaky DNS in the Verdane edge tier. Resolution against the internal resolver pool intermittently returns stale records after a zone push, causing TLS name mismatches in the Orlyn gateway. Mitigation: flush the resolver cache, then re-run the probe suite twice. All occurrences are logged with full query context. The trace token for the last confirmed incident appears below.

session token of kafof-kafop = htk31_c3becf8b8eac3ed970037fba36e258e

## Releases

Meltcask v4 caps spreadsheet export memory at 512 MB per worker. Exports stream row-by-row now; the old full-buffer path is gone. If an export exceeds the cap, it aborts and logs a truncation event — do not raise the cap without profiling. Cut releases from the stable branch only. Tag, build, run the memory regression suite, then sign the artifact before pushing to the Harlowick registry. The build must be signed with the key below.

rollout seal: bky4_x7Gc